In the Bay of Fundy, Canada, mysterious rocks line the cliffs. They look like giant faces facing the ocean. Nobody knows the secret of thees strange guardians and yet, they could talk, they would tell a fabulous story.


The story begins when Alma follows Azimut, the little puffin, in a mysterious cave, hidden in the cliff...
